IE in the newsOn September 15, the Wisconsin State Journal published an op ed piece entitled, "State Can Beat Overseas Competitors." Author Rajan Suri, director of the Center for Quick Response Manufacturing, discussed how the center has been working with Wisconsin companies to stay competitive with overseas manufacturing operations. In addition, the QRM Center and its work with Datex Ohmeda was the lead story on WKOW, Channel 27 news on September 25. For more information, see www.qrmcenter.org. The July 2003 issue of Industrial Engineer, the magazine of the Institute of Industrial Engineers, featured a project the Consortium for Global eCommerce conducted with CUNA Mutual, the Credit Union Executives Society, and CUNA and Affiliates. The groups worked together to develop a roadmap for credit unions to adopt websites and advance their e-commerce strategies. A July 8 story in the British newspaper The Guardian mentioned major National Cancer Institute funding for a group led by Professor Emeritus David Gustafson.
